Airbnb: Around $100 a night for a one-bedroom apartment in one of the above areas, provided you book enough in advance. Street/small vendor food (burekas, shawerma, falafel, hummus): around $5-8 for a meal for one. Sit-down food that’s fancier: about $15-20 a dish. Pay about $50 for two, before drinks. .
